Rashford's Match-Winning Performance

A Brace of Brilliant Goals

Rashford's brace was the highlight of the match, showcasing his incredible talent and clinical finishing. The Rashford goals were instrumental in securing the Man Utd victory and propelling them further in the FA Cup.

  • First Goal (22nd minute): A powerful, low drive from just outside the box, after a clever turn and a perfectly weighted pass from Bruno Fernandes. The shot flew past the outstretched hand of the Aston Villa goalkeeper, sparking wild celebrations among the United fans. This Rashford goal was a testament to his power and precision.
  • Second Goal (67th minute): A stunning header from a perfectly placed cross by Luke Shaw. Rashford rose majestically above the Villa defense to power the ball into the back of the net. This FA Cup goal demonstrated his aerial prowess and timing. The Rashford brace was complete.
